Just starting to catch up on the Nintendo conference. I'm not a big Nintendo fan, I tend to think the Wii is a joke, though my niece and nephew love it, and it is hysterical watching my 60yr old parents try to play it with them. Annoyingly 2 of their 4 controllers have died in less than a year. I have a DS and a dozen or so games, that I haven't touched in well over a year. This doesn't bode well.
I just got to the part about the new Zelda game, so Nintendo is leading from their strengths as aside from Mario games it is probably the game most looked for. It looks good for a Wii game, but that's the problem. I'm already having issues. The controls are not as easy or responsive as Shigeru would have us believe, they certainly aren't smooth as they could be. If the game's developer has this many basic issues there's a problem. And I can't help but think that the game would look better and play better on a PS3 with a Move controller. Not only would the graphics be much better, with higher frame rate, everything I've seen so far suggests the Move simply blows the wiimote out of the water for speed and accuracy. Wii games tend to work best when a cartoony graphical theme is used, it doesn't handle realism well. I will give them credit for making fun of Apple with the turn off the wireless comments. The demo is very long, who needs to see every tool? For a game that won't be out till next year.
Yawn Wii Party. Oh look a new Nintendo dance game that looks tragic compared to the one shown for 360 and Kinect yesterday (though I'm still not convinced the kinect game really works). I really wish more companies would drop the boring stat list, one of the few pluses for MS yesterday was not doing the same old look how great we are.
GoldenEye, one of the few none Mario Nintendo games I think actually deserved the acclaim it got. Too bad it is on the Wii and looks generations out of date. Strange that they replaced Pierce Brosnan as Bond with Daniel Craig but didn't pick a new film to base the game around. So it looks like a moderate graphical and engine improvement coupled with a wiimote remake of the original. The original was a fair bit of fun in 4 player multiplayer, but is this update enough to make it worth the time? Guess we'll find out. Nostalgia gaming at its best, the kids who didn't play the first game likely won't be that impressed.
Epic Mickey might be the only title the Wii has or will ever get that I'm actually annoyed won't be on another platform, though rumors suggest that may one day change. Again though, shame it is on the Wii. The game looks more ambitious than the Wii can really handle.
Kirby's Epic Yarn, on the one hand it might well be the best looking game Wii has, on the other is the least interesting game so far in the presentation. Metroid: Other M is another game that looks good for a Wii game, but I'm noticing a lot of "for a Wii game" in my reactions. Nintendo really needs to produce a new more powerful Wii and get close to this generation rather than playing in the past. It doesn't help that I really dislike how the Wiimote is used in most Wii games, so rarely does it really improve game play. And maybe it is just me but Donkey Country Returns actually looks a bit like a graphical step back from the N64 editions, though it'll probably still be fun.
Nearly 30 minutes devoted to the 3DS. New thumb stick. Same touch screen. Can view movies, likely must mean a big memory card or internal memory has been added. 3D camera. Always on wireless and wifi access, not sure I like that. Sounds like some form of multi-tasking, again suggesting a big memory card, and maybe download software or software installations. Sounds like a pretty significant upgrade from the DS, but still feels a bit like a a half step towards the modern hardware, sort of like they aimed to not quite match the PSP for power but added some decent features to try make up for it. Would like to see how well the 3D screen actually works, not really thinking I'll buy one though.
The crowd reaction was less enthusiastic than I'd expected, most shots of the crowd showed only a few people cheering. But overall I'd say Nintendo did a lot better than MS did. The presentation was largely kid friendly, and like Sony they did stats which are always boring. However I had to pause this to watch Sony's presentation which largely just kills the other two. There weren't as many game announcements as I would have expected, and very little in the way of third party support which is odd for the top selling machine of the generation.

It appears there is also a remake for Legend of Zelda:OOT coming to the 3DS. Apparently it was listed/leaked(including screenshots) on Nintendo's E3 website, but later pulled from the site by Nintendo.
http://www.1up.com/do/blogEntry?bId=9033963
Edit: Confirmed by NOA on their twitter page.
